(Puttin' on the) Ritz Cracker Baked Flounder


(Before)

This is my buttery Ritz cracker baked flounder / sole dish.

First soak 6-8 small thawed fillet's of sole or flounder in fresh lemon juice for 20min. While these are soaking, crush 25-35 Ritz (or other similar buttery crackers) in a bowl.

Mix into crackers 3tbs. melted butter. Add finely chopped and cooked onion and 2tbs finely chopped scallions.

Heat 3lbs butter (or I prefer SmartBalance) and coat the bottom of a Pyrex dish. Place 1/2 the number of fillets on the bottom of pan. Drizzle the butter/margarine mix over the fish and spoon the cracker/onion mix ontop of fish.
Then add the second layer of fish and repeat (covering the second layer of fish with mixture).
Finally bake between 350-400 degrees depending on the thickness of the fillets.

Serve with a small salad or slaw.
